Common side effects associated with semaglutide include nausea, vomiting, diarrhea, and constipation. These are often referred to as gastrointestinal side effects and are typically mild to moderate in severity. In some cases, these can lead to discontinuation of the medication. Indeed, in semaglutide's 68-week trial, discontinuation rates were around 5-7%, largely attributed to these gastrointestinal issues.

However, retatrutide also comes with its own set of potential adverse effects. Similar to semaglutide, retatrutide side effects have been mild to moderate in early studies and often include nausea, diarrhea, vomiting, and constipation. Some sources suggest that retatrutide may have fewer or less severe gastrointestinal side effects. For instance, one study indicated that while 7% of participants receiving retatrutide experienced changes in skin sensation like tingling, these were not a significant concern and were not the primary reason for discontinuation.

Another key point is that both retatrutide and semaglutide are considered safe when used appropriately, and many of the reported side effects are manageable. In fact, some individuals report that retatrutide is among the weight loss medications offering the best side effects profile, although this is subjective and dependent on individual response.
It's also worth mentioning that retatrutide is a weight-loss medication that's in development. Therefore, long-term, prospective studies are still needed to fully understand its safety and efficacy profile, especially in comparison to established treatments like semaglutide.
